Laurie Anne
Hurwitz
Apr 8, 1974 — Jun 21, 2024
Laurie A. Hurwitz, age 50, of Drexel Hill, PA, passed away surrounded by family on Friday, June 21, 2024.
Laurie was a life long resident of Drexel Hill. She graduated from Upper Darby High School in 1992. She continued her education in Health and Physical Education at East Stroudsburg University, and earned her Master's at Gratz College. She went on to become a Health and Physical Education Teacher for the Philadelphia School District over 20 years.
Laurie was very much involved, and loved sports throughout her life. She was a talented softball, field hockey, and basketball player. When not on the field playing, she enjoyed being a coach and a referee. She also served as a PIAA softball umpire. She was well loved by the Drexel Hill Challengers baseball team players, coaches, and families. When not on the baseball field, Laurie spent her happiest times watching the Pittsburgh Steelers, Phillies, Flyers, and Chicago Blackhawks.
Laurie especially loved being a mom, and her very special title as Aunt Laurie to her nieces and nephews. She loved her cats too. She enjoyed spending time with her family watching sports, listening to music and seeing bands perform, playing video games, and spending time at her beach home. The 4th of July, Halloween, Christmas, and family birthdays were very special time for her. She liked to show off her juggling skills and followed her grandfather's passion for doing magic tricks at a young age.
Laurie was predeceased by her father, Edward Hurwitz, Grandparents, Morton and Gertrude Hurwitz, and Nicholas and Paraskevi Prokovas, and brother William Hurwitz. She is survived and will be forever loved by her son Nicholas Campson, longtime fiancé Robert Flood, Mother, Kortesa Prokovas, sister Donna Freas, nieces Alyssa & Evangeline Culpepper (Colin) , Pamela Hurwitz (Justin) , Haelle Woy, nephews, Sean Patrick and Ryan Freas, and her cats Sammy and Sharky.
Relatives and friends are invited to her graveside ceremony on Monday, July 1st, 2024 at 12:30 p.m. at Glenwood Memorial Gardens (section R) located at 2321 West Chester Pike, Broomall, PA 19008. Formal attire NOT required. Favorite sports teams, band shirts, gamer shirts, or shirts with cats are encouraged.
